Two root-cause fixes surfaced by cluster smoke v74v4 (sweep_smoke-a2dfc6d99):

Bug D — DBN parser price scaling:
- BidAskPair::price_to_f64/price_from_f64 used /1e12 / *1e12 from test-data
  calibration. DBN production uses 1e-9 nanoprice (the DBN standard). ES at
  5500 raw 5_500_000_000_000 → 5.5 instead of 5500. Smoke trade records
  showed entry_px=5.24 instead of expected ~5240 ES index points (1000×
  too small). Fix: 1e12 → 1e9 in both functions. Round-trip symmetric;
  tests updated.

Bug C-b — corrupt top-of-book sentinel:
- Per-level sanitization (Task 15) zeros each unhealthy MBP-10 level
  individually. At session-boundary events with all 10 levels invalid,
  the book becomes uniformly zero. apply_fill_to_pos then reads
  bid_px[0]=0 / ask_px[0]=0 → vwap_entry=0 → trade record entry_px=0
  (zero sentinel in v74v4 CSV, 162/1024 trades in n59t4).
- Fix: pre-validate top-of-book in apply_snapshot_kernel. If
  bid_px[0]/ask_px[0]/bid_sz[0]/ask_sz[0] are non-finite or
  bid_px[0]<=0/ask_px[0]<=0/bid_sz[0]<=0/ask_sz[0]<=0, atomically skip
  the entire snapshot (book/prev_mid/atr_mid_ema unchanged). Add
  per-backtest snapshots_skipped_d counter for observability.

Test corrupt_top_of_book_skips_snapshot_and_increments_counter validates
NaN top-price + zero top-size cases both increment the counter without
mutating state, and that a subsequent valid snapshot updates normally.

Foxhunt

Production HFT trading system in Rust.

Architecture

The workspace contains 32 crates organized as follows:

Core Libraries (16)

Crate Purpose
trading_engine Order processing, FIX 4.4, IB TWS, SIMD, RDTSC timing
risk VaR, Kelly, circuit breakers, kill switches, compliance
risk-data Risk data types and shared structures
trading-data Trading data types
ml DQN Rainbow, PPO, TFT, Mamba2, ensemble inference
ml-data ML data types and feature definitions
data Market data ingestion and storage
backtesting Replay engine, strategy tester
adaptive-strategy Ensemble execution, microstructure analysis
common Shared types, resilience, error handling
storage S3 and local model storage
model_loader Model serialization and loading
market-data Market data feed handlers
database PostgreSQL access layer (SQLx)
config Configuration management
tli CLI commands and tooling

ML Models

Four production model architectures on Candle v0.9.1 with CUDA:

  • DQN Rainbow -- Deep Q-Network with prioritized replay, dueling heads, noisy nets
  • PPO -- Proximal Policy Optimization with GAE and LSTM policies
  • TFT -- Temporal Fusion Transformer for multi-horizon forecasting
  • Mamba2 -- State space model for sequence prediction

Each model has a standalone trainer and a UnifiedTrainable adapter for the hyperopt pipeline.
